  "account": "TORM, a company specializing in product tankers, reported its highest ever quarterly earnings on August 26. The company's second-quarter TCE earnings surpassed $512 million, more than double the $208 million from the same period a year prior. This surge in earnings was not a result of new ship acquisitions or strategic trading but rather disruptions in the Strait of Hormuz. This geopolitical turmoil redirected tankers around the Cape of Good Hope, turning scarce vessel capacity into high demand and profit. The company's financial metrics improved significantly, with EBITDA rising from $127 million to $416 million, and earnings per share increasing from $0.60 to $3.31. Management raised full-year TCE guidance to $1.4 billion to $1.6 billion and EBITDA guidance to $1.0 billion to $1.2 billion. The company also approved a dividend payout of $2.40 per share, a $246 million distribution. Despite increased operating expenses and a higher hedge fund ownership, the forward P/E ratio remains low at 4.84, signaling potential investment value. However, the company also acknowledges the risks, as geopolitical events could quickly shift the company's fortunes.",
